    This mod works with some light sources and others do not work, does anyone know how to solve it?

      Actually they're all working, this issue is because the default radius value is too small for these "not working" particle lights

      Here's my solution:
      If you're using LLF Particle Lights instead of Fake Glow along with Light Limit Fix, open ...\LLF Particle Lights instead of Fake Glow\ParticleLights\glowsoft01.ini then raise the value of "RadiusMult =" to a proper amount, I set it to 8.0, this makes those sources cast lights on grass to the range I see fit

      If you feel it's not bright enough, open ...\Community Shaders\SKSE\Plugins\CommunityShaders.json and raise the value of "ParticleLightsBrightness": I set this value to 2.0 and now everything works like a charm

    So I need BOTH enb and community shaders for this mod to work? I am not sure if I understood the requirements correctly.

      No. This requires Community Shaders which is incompatible with enb. CS will disable itself if enb is detected and this will not work at all.
